Senior Director of Manufacturing Engineering
Feb 2007 — Present · San Francisco, CA, US
Direct a diverse team covering sustaining, process development, integration, product and lean engineering functions covering area of MOCVD epitaxy, wafer fab, die fabrication, metrology, sorting, wafer-level and chip-level testing, and failure analysis. The optical and optoelectronics devices include edge-emitting high-power lasers (FP, DFB), edge-emitting high-speed lasers (DML, EML, DFB-MZ), tunable lasers, vertical cavity surface-emitting lasers (VCSEL), waveguides, modulators, detectors (APD, PIN), diffractive optics (transmission & reflection optical gratings), gain chips and photonics integrated circuits (PICs). Spearhead and execute fab technology roadmap, new product introduction, total quality management, yield improvement, statistical process control (SPC), failure analysis, process/product transfer, Kaizen and lean program, cost reduction, new capabilities, standardization, fab automation, best practices, wafer line upgrade (GaAs, InP, LiNbO3, glass), production training, environmental sustainability initiatives. i.e. tunable laser PICs yield improvement from single digit to over 90% in six months, resulting in an annual savings of $17M and increased revenue from a 30% capacity addition. Introduce and oversee five generations of optical gratings and diffractive optics technology from concept through R&D stage to mass production (over 30 SKUs). i.e. innovative fabrication efficiency implementation by 30% removal in non-value added processing steps enabling shorter cycle time and 50% product standard cost saving (from increased yield and reduced labor) universal for entire product family.
